I get what you are trying to do, but you cant increase pressure by making a big funnel for air. whatever the pressure is at the front of the car, thats the pressure that will be forcing air into the duct. better to actually just take air from the base of the windshield. pressure measured there vs the nose is pretty darn close. also keep in mind that the most you ever could expect, with the most efficient ram scoop out there, would be .08psi at 80mph. less than 1% gain in power. at 160mph, that figure jumps to .35psi , or just over 2%.
